The retail challenge: shared infrastructure, variable operating models
Retail is one of the most governance-sensitive SaaS environments because operational variation is high while tolerance for disruption is low. A fashion chain, grocery distributor, electronics reseller, and franchise convenience network may all run on the same platform, yet each has different inventory velocity, returns logic, supplier dependencies, and point-of-sale integration requirements.
If the platform lacks governance, service quality becomes dependent on individual implementation teams, custom scripts, or reseller practices. That leads to inconsistent deployment environments, weak tenant isolation, reporting gaps, and support escalation patterns that erode customer confidence. In recurring revenue businesses, these issues directly affect retention, expansion, and gross margin.
| Governance domain | Retail risk without control | Enterprise outcome with control |
|---|---|---|
| Tenant configuration | Inconsistent store setup and pricing logic | Standardized deployment templates and policy-based provisioning |
| Release management | Feature conflicts across merchant groups | Controlled rollout waves with tenant segmentation |
| Embedded ERP workflows | Broken inventory, finance, or procurement synchronization | Reliable workflow orchestration across connected business systems |
| Support operations | Uneven SLA performance across regions or partners | Measured service consistency with shared operational playbooks |
| Subscription operations | Billing disputes and poor revenue visibility | Governed recurring revenue infrastructure and usage transparency |
What governance means in a multi-tenant retail SaaS platform
Multi-tenant SaaS governance is the operating framework that defines how tenants are provisioned, isolated, monitored, upgraded, supported, and monetized on a shared platform. It combines technical controls with business process discipline. In retail, that includes catalog governance, workflow orchestration, role-based access, integration standards, release approvals, service-level policies, and data visibility rules.
This is especially important when the platform includes embedded ERP capabilities such as purchasing, inventory planning, warehouse operations, supplier management, invoicing, or financial reconciliation. Embedded ERP ecosystems increase platform value, but they also increase dependency. A governance failure in one workflow can affect store replenishment, order accuracy, customer service, and revenue recognition at the same time.
The most mature retail providers treat governance as part of enterprise SaaS infrastructure. They do not leave consistency to manual oversight. They codify it into tenant templates, policy engines, observability layers, API controls, onboarding workflows, and partner certification models.
Core governance principles that improve service consistency
- Define a service baseline for every tenant, including performance thresholds, support response models, release cadence, security controls, and integration standards.
- Separate configurable tenant variation from unsupported customization so the platform remains scalable without creating operational exceptions.
- Use policy-based provisioning for stores, brands, and franchise entities to reduce onboarding inconsistency and implementation delays.
- Govern embedded ERP workflows through versioned APIs, event monitoring, and exception handling rather than ad hoc connector logic.
- Align subscription operations, usage tracking, and billing governance so recurring revenue reflects actual service delivery and contracted entitlements.
- Establish partner and reseller operating rules to ensure white-label or OEM delivery models do not degrade platform quality.
A realistic retail SaaS scenario: franchise expansion without governance
Consider a retail technology provider serving 180 franchise operators across apparel, home goods, and specialty food. The company offers a white-label commerce and ERP platform that includes inventory visibility, supplier ordering, store analytics, and subscription billing. Growth is strong, but each new franchise group is onboarded with slightly different workflows because regional implementation teams use their own templates.
Within 12 months, the provider faces recurring issues: some tenants receive delayed stock updates, others have inconsistent tax mappings, and support teams cannot compare service health because environments are configured differently. Billing disputes increase because premium workflow automation is enabled in some tenants without clean entitlement tracking. Churn risk rises not because the product lacks value, but because service consistency has become unpredictable.
A governance-led redesign would standardize tenant classes, define approved integration patterns, automate store provisioning, and create a release governance board for franchise-impacting changes. The result is not less flexibility. It is controlled flexibility that protects operational scalability.
Platform engineering controls that support governance at scale
Retail providers cannot govern multi-tenant environments through policy documents alone. Governance must be enforced through platform engineering. That means tenant-aware observability, infrastructure-as-code, environment parity, role-based administration, feature flag governance, and automated compliance checks across production workflows.
For example, a provider supporting both direct customers and reseller-managed tenants should maintain segmented deployment pipelines. Core services can remain shared, but configuration promotion, extension approval, and release timing should be governed by tenant tier, geography, and operational criticality. This reduces the risk that one partner-specific change affects the broader tenant population.
| Platform engineering control | Governance purpose | Retail service impact |
|---|---|---|
| Tenant-aware monitoring | Detect performance variance by merchant group | Faster issue isolation and more consistent SLA delivery |
| Feature flag governance | Control release exposure by tenant segment | Safer rollout of pricing, POS, and ERP workflow changes |
| Infrastructure-as-code | Standardize environments across regions and partners | Reduced onboarding errors and deployment drift |
| API version governance | Protect embedded ERP interoperability | Stable supplier, finance, and inventory integrations |
| Automated entitlement checks | Align usage with subscription plans | Cleaner billing operations and stronger recurring revenue visibility |
Embedded ERP governance is central to retail consistency
Retail service consistency depends heavily on back-office execution. A storefront may look stable while inventory allocation, purchasing approvals, returns processing, or supplier invoicing are failing behind the scenes. That is why embedded ERP governance should be treated as a first-class platform concern, not a secondary integration layer.
In practice, this means defining canonical data models for products, locations, suppliers, and financial events; governing workflow dependencies across order capture and fulfillment; and monitoring exception queues that affect downstream operations. When embedded ERP processes are standardized, retail providers can deliver more reliable replenishment, margin reporting, and customer service outcomes across all tenants.
This also creates a stronger OEM ERP and white-label ERP foundation. Resellers can extend the platform for vertical use cases, but they do so within governed workflow boundaries. That protects the provider's operating model while allowing ecosystem growth.
Governance and recurring revenue infrastructure are directly connected
Many SaaS operators separate governance from monetization, but in retail platforms they are tightly linked. If service tiers, automation modules, transaction volumes, and support entitlements are not governed consistently, subscription operations become opaque. Finance teams struggle to reconcile usage, customer success teams cannot explain value realization, and account expansion becomes harder to justify.
A governed recurring revenue infrastructure connects tenant entitlements, billing logic, service telemetry, and lifecycle milestones. For example, if a retailer upgrades to advanced replenishment automation, the platform should automatically provision the capability, track adoption, monitor workflow success, and reflect the entitlement in billing and reporting. This reduces leakage while improving customer trust.
Operational automation reduces inconsistency without reducing control
Automation is often positioned as a speed tool, but in enterprise SaaS it is equally a governance tool. Retail providers can automate tenant onboarding, role assignment, integration validation, release approvals, incident routing, and renewal readiness checks. The objective is not simply efficiency. It is repeatability across a growing tenant base.
A strong example is automated onboarding for new store groups. Instead of manually configuring tax settings, warehouse mappings, user roles, and supplier connectors, the platform can apply a governed template based on region, retail format, and subscription tier. Human teams then focus on exceptions and optimization rather than repetitive setup work.
- Automate tenant provisioning with approved configuration blueprints.
- Trigger integration health checks before go-live and after major releases.
- Route workflow exceptions to the correct operational team based on business impact.
- Use lifecycle automation to flag low adoption, renewal risk, or support overuse by tenant segment.
- Create partner onboarding automation so resellers follow the same deployment governance model as direct teams.
